Как устроены серверные операционные системы
Серверные операционные системы являют собой специфическое программное обеспечение для администрирования аппаратурными возможностями компьютера. Конструкция таких систем базируется на базе многозадачности и многопользовательского подключения. Ядро организует функционирование процессора, оперативной памяти, дисковых накопителей и сетевых интерфейсов.
Фундамент образует модульная архитектура, где каждый модуль исполняет конкретные операции. Драйверы предоставляют взаимодействие с материальным устройствами. Планировщик задач распределяет вычислительные возможности между задачами. Файловая система организует сохранение информации на носителях.
Серверная вавада включает службы для обслуживания сетевых запросов и запуска сервисов. Системные библиотеки дают процессам встроенные процедуры для взаимодействия с средствами. Системы изоляции процессов устраняют столкновения между процессами.
Интерфейс командной строки позволяет управляющим регулировать установки и контролировать положение системы. Логи событий фиксируют информацию о функционировании компонентов вавада онлайн казино. Такая конфигурация обеспечивает стабильную деятельность оборудования под большой нагруженностью.
Чем серверная ОС различается от обычной
Основное различие кроется в функции и методе применения. Настольные системы заточены на работу одного юзера с графическими программами. Серверные платформы поддерживают множество параллельных коннектов и реализуют скрытые операции без вмешательства человека.
Графический интерфейс в серверных вариантах часто отсутствует или упрощен. Администрирование производится через командную строку и настроечные файлы. Такой способ снижает затраты возможностей и поднимает быстродействие. Пользовательские версии дают визуальные средства для обычных задач.
Серверные платформы обеспечивают улучшенные опции расширения. Системы vavada работают с крупными размерами памяти и совокупностью процессорных ядер. Надежность и бесперебойность деятельности чрезвычайно существенны для серверного программного обеспечения. Системы конструируются для круглосуточного действия без перезагрузок. Системы дублирования защищают от неполадок. Пользовательские редакции терпят регулярные рестарты и менее притязательны к отказоустойчивости.
Ключевые цели серверных систем
Серверные платформы реализуют спектр функций по гарантированию деятельности сетевых служб и приложений:
- Обработка входящих сетевых коннектов и маршрутизация потока.
- Запуск и отслеживание деятельности пользовательских утилит и веб-сервисов.
- Деление процессорной мощности между запущенными процессами.
- Мониторинг состояния физических элементов и софтверных блоков.
- Ведение записей событий для оценки скорости.
Программное обеспечение координирует взаимодействие между клиентными машинами и вычислительными ресурсами. Конструкция обеспечивает синхронно выполнять тысячи запросов от множественных операторов.
Сохранение и управление сведениями составляет главную функцию серверных платформ. Файловые хранилища предоставляют доступ к файлам, медиафайлам и архивам. Системы управления базами данных обрабатывают организованную данные. Средства архивного дублирования предохраняют значимые данные от исчезновения.
Решение обеспечивает обособление клиентских сред и приложений. Виртуализация дает активировать несколько автономных казино вавада на одном аппаратном хосте. Выравнивание загрузки выделяет задачи между свободными средствами для максимальной эффективности.
Как обрабатываются запросы клиентов
Цикл обработки начинается с поступления обращения через сетевой интерфейс. Поступающее коннект помещается в очередь, где ожидает своей черед. Сетевой слой анализирует порции данных и определяет требуемый сервис. Маршрутизатор отправляет запрос подходящему софтверному блоку.
Программа извлекает информацию и производит требуемые действия. Приложение может запросить к файловой системе для считывания или сохранения сведений. База данных предоставляет затребованные элементы. Расчетные действия осуществляются процессором согласно первоочередности операции.
Многопоточная архитектура позволяет осуществлять совокупность запросов одновременно. Каждое соединение обретает отдельный нить обработки. Планировщик делит вычислительное время между работающими процессами. Серверная вавада отслеживает использование памяти и предотвращает перегрузку ресурсов.
Сгенерированный результат высылается обратно заказчику через сетевое подключение. Протоколы транспортного яруса обеспечивают пересылку данных. Протокол сохраняет сведения о исполненной задаче и состоянии окончания. Очищенные ресурсы становятся доступными для очередных обращений.
Контроль ресурсами и нагрузкой
Эффективное распределение ресурсов гарантирует стабильную деятельность всех модулей. Планировщик задач выявляет важности задач и выделяет вычислительное время. Схемы выравнивания предотвращают переполнение отдельных модулей. Мониторинг проверяет настоящее статус аппаратуры в настоящем режиме.
Оперативная память разносится между запущенными приложениями автоматически. Механизм свопинга применяет дисковое место при недостатке физической памяти. Кэширование ускоряет подключение к регулярно требуемым информации. Самостоятельная уборка высвобождает неиспользуемые сегменты памяти.
Дисковые действия ускоряются через очереди обращений и опережающее считывание. Файловая система объединяет связанные сведения для снижения времени доступа. Серверные vavada обеспечивают оперативную подмену дисков без прекращения функционирования.
Сетевая подсистема регулирует передающую способность каналов связи. Лимитирование темпа блокирует захват bandwidth конкретными подключениями. Приоритизация потока предоставляет уровень обслуживания значимых сервисов. Метрики нагрузки помогает планировать расширение системы.
Охрана и регулирование подключения
Обеспечение сведений и возможностей выстраивается на иерархической системе разграничения полномочий. Каждый клиент обретает уникальный идентификатор и совокупность привилегий. Аутентификация проверяет подлинность регистрационных профилей при авторизации. Пароли хранятся в криптованном виде для предотвращения неавторизованного подключения.
Права доступа к документам и папкам конфигурируются индивидуально для каждого объекта. Собственник ресурса определяет позволенные процедуры для остальных операторов. Объединения собирают пользовательские аккаунты с схожими привилегиями. Серверная казино вавада пресекает действия реализации неразрешенных операций.
Сетевой брандмауэр отсеивает входящий и выходной трафик по определенным правилам. Перечни контроля сужают соединения с заданных IP-адресов. Системы выявления проникновений изучают странную активность. Кодирование предохраняет транспортируемую данные от перехвата.
Протоколы безопасности фиксируют все попытки обращения к ограниченным объектам. Проверка событий способствует определить несоблюдения правил. Автоматизированные уведомления извещают управляющих о серьезных происшествиях. Периодическое актуализация параметров подстраивает решение к актуальным угрозам.
Функционирование с сетью и соединениями
Сетевая подсистема предоставляет взаимодействие сервера с удаленными терминалами и иными серверами. Сетевые интерфейсы принимают и пересылают информацию по множественным форматам. Драйверы адаптеров управляют материальными портами. Установка IP-адресов регулирует идентификацию узла в сети.
Стек протоколов TCP/IP осуществляет передачу данных на множественных ярусах. Перенаправление ведет блоки к назначенным точкам через кратчайшие направления. DNS-резолвер конвертирует доменные имена в numeric идентификаторы. DHCP самостоятельно выделяет сетевые параметры подсоединенным аппаратам.
Управление подключениями включает надзор активных подключений и таймаутов. Группы коннектов вторично задействуют открытые линии для экономии средств. Серверные вавада поддерживают тысячи параллельных TCP-соединений за счет эффективным механизмам. Распределители разносят входящий данные между разными хостами.
Контроль сетевой поведения отслеживает транспортную производительность и отклики. Тестовые инструменты тестируют доступность дистанционных узлов. Статистика адаптеров демонстрирует величины пересланных сведений и объем отказов. Регулировка буферов повышает скорость при множественных формах загрузки.
Обновления и поддержание решения
Регулярное актуализация программного обеспечения гарантирует защищенность и стабильность функционирования. Создатели издают патчи для исправления уязвимостей и неисправностей. Системы пакетов упрощают получение и инсталляцию патчей. Администраторы проектируют внедрение изменений в интервалы минимальной загрузки.
Испытание обновлений на отдельных контекстах исключает непредвиденные ошибки. Архивное копирование параметров обеспечивает моментально откатить корректировки при сбоях. Серверная vavada предоставляет механизмы возврата к предыдущим редакциям компонентов.
Наблюдение положения отслеживает наличие свежих релизов приложений и библиотек. Уведомления оповещают о важных апдейтах охраны. Автоматические проверки определяют deprecated блоки. Регламенты обновления задают первоочередности и сроки внедрения модификаций.
Техническая сервис производителей предоставляет рекомендации по настройке и исправлению неисправностей. Группа пользователей распространяет практикой реализации вопросов. Хранилища знаний хранят мануалы по настройке. Платные договоры гарантируют доступ патчей в продолжение заданного интервала.
Где используются серверные операционные системы
Веб-хостинг является одну из базовых областей использования серверных платформ. Организации размещают ресурсы и веб-приложения на dedicated или виртуальных узлах. Системы осуществляют HTTP-запросы от миллионов посетителей постоянно.
Корпоративные сети строятся на серверную архитектуру для размещения информации и выполнения бизнес-приложений. Файловые серверы обеспечивают общий подключение к документам. Почтовые платформы обрабатывают сообщения предприятия. Базы данных включают сведения о клиентах и денежных операциях.
Облачные поставщики формируют гибкие платформы на основе серверных систем. Виртуализация дает организовывать отдельные контексты для разных заказчиков. Серверные казино вавада обеспечивают адаптивность и производительность облачных услуг.
Академические расчеты требуют высокопроизводительных серверных систем для выполнения больших объемов сведений. Научные институты моделируют комплексные процессы. Медицинские организации содержат электронные записи клиентов на охраняемых машинах. Образовательные порталы предоставляют подключение к образовательным контенту.
